Web18 sep. 2024 · If your mobile home is on private property, another option is to install an underground tornado shelter made of concrete, steel, or fiberglass. These bomb-shelterlike structures cost anywhere from $2,500 to $10,000. According to Iowa law , a city can require the … the american patriot\u0027s handbookWebThere are no safe areas in any mobile home and you should not attempt to shelter from a tornado in a mobile home. If you live in an apartment or rental housing, ask the manager if there is a shelter for residents to use, either on property or nearby.
